Email
Enterprise Service
menu
Email
Enterprise Service
Submit
Basic information
Waiting for a reply
Your form has been submitted. We'll contact you in 24 hours.
Close
Home/ Blog/ How to test the speed and stability of a proxy server?

How to test the speed and stability of a proxy server?

Author:PYPROXY
2025-03-11

Testing the speed and stability of proxy servers is essential to ensure that users get the best experience. A proxy server is an intermediary between a client and the internet, and its primary function is to enhance privacy, bypass restrictions, or improve network speed. However, not all proxies perform equally, and a poor-performing proxy can affect browsing, streaming, and online activities. To determine whether a proxy is suitable for your needs, it’s important to test its speed and stability. This article will guide you through several effective methods to evaluate these aspects of proxy servers, helping you make an informed decision when choosing a proxy service.

Understanding the Importance of Proxy Speed and Stability

Before diving into the testing methods, it's important to understand why the speed and stability of proxy servers matter. Proxy servers essentially act as middlemen for your data requests. When you connect to the internet through a proxy, all your data first passes through this intermediary server. If the proxy server is slow or unstable, this delay can significantly affect your online activities. Speed issues can result in slower page loading times, buffering during streaming, and lag in online gaming. Stability, on the other hand, refers to the ability of the proxy to maintain a consistent connection without frequent disconnects or service interruptions. Both of these factors are crucial for any user relying on a proxy for daily internet activities.

Methods to Test Proxy Speed

There are several ways to test the speed of a proxy server. Let’s explore the most common and effective ones.

1. Use Speed Test Websites

One of the simplest ways to test proxy speed is by using speed test websites. These platforms allow you to measure the ping, download speed, and upload speed while connected to the proxy server. Some well-known speed testing services even provide server locations, allowing you to compare the performance of different proxy servers. To perform this test, follow these steps:

- Connect to the proxy server.

- Visit a speed testing website.

- Record the results, including ping, download, and upload speeds.

By performing this test, you can gauge how the proxy server impacts your connection speed compared to your normal, direct connection.

2. Test With a Reliable VPN

If you are using a proxy to bypass geographic restrictions or access content from specific regions, you can combine it with a VPN for added security and compare the speeds. While VPNs encrypt your traffic, proxy servers don’t always offer the same level of encryption. Testing both services under the same conditions can provide insights into the speed difference when using a proxy versus a VPN. Some VPN providers include speed-testing tools that can also help you assess proxy performance.

3. Run Multiple Speed Tests Over Time

Speed is not a constant metric; it can fluctuate due to several factors like network congestion, the time of day, and even the distance between the proxy server and your physical location. To accurately assess proxy speed, run speed tests at different times of day and over multiple days. This will help you understand the typical performance of the proxy server, considering all variables that could affect its speed.

Methods to Test Proxy Stability

Stability is another important metric to assess when testing proxy servers. A proxy that disconnects frequently or fails to maintain a consistent connection will cause frustration for the user.

1. Continuous Ping Test

A continuous ping test can be a great way to monitor the stability of a proxy server. Pinging a server repeatedly helps measure the reliability of the connection. By monitoring the number of successful pings and the time it takes for each ping to return, you can get a sense of the proxy’s stability. Use the following method for this test:

- Open a command prompt or terminal window on your computer.

- Type the command “ping [proxy server IP address] -t” (replace [proxy server IP address] with the actual IP of your proxy server).

- Observe the results. If the ping times are consistent and there are few packet losses, the proxy is stable.

If you notice frequent timeouts or significant variations in ping time, it suggests that the proxy server is unstable or experiencing connection issues.

2. Monitor Connection Drops

Another way to test the stability of a proxy server is to monitor for connection drops. This can be done by using network monitoring tools that check whether the proxy server remains connected over extended periods. Tools such as “PingPlotter” or “Wireshark” can provide insights into connection issues, including packet loss or delays that may indicate instability. These tools can log connection drops, enabling you to pinpoint times when the proxy is unreliable.

3. Long-Duration Stress Test

A long-duration stress test involves keeping the proxy connection active for an extended period, such as several hours or even days. During this time, you can engage in regular internet activities like browsing, streaming, or gaming. The goal is to check if the proxy server can handle continuous usage without disconnecting or slowing down significantly. You may use specialized software to simulate continuous traffic, or simply rely on your own usage over time. If the proxy maintains a stable connection throughout the test period, it is a sign of its reliability.

Additional Factors to Consider When Testing Proxy Servers

While speed and stability are crucial, there are a few other factors you should consider when evaluating proxy servers.

1. Proxy Type

Different proxy types—such as HTTP, HTTPS, SOCKS5, and residential proxies—have different performance characteristics. For instance, sock s5 proxies are generally more flexible and support a wider range of applications, while HTTP proxies might be more efficient for specific tasks like web browsing. When testing proxies, consider how well the specific type you are using suits your needs.

2. Proxy Location

The physical location of a proxy server can impact both its speed and stability. A proxy server located far from your geographical region might introduce higher latency and slower speeds. Additionally, the location of the proxy server can influence its ability to bypass geographical restrictions. Choose a server location that is close to your physical location to reduce latency.

3. Server Load

The load on a proxy server plays a significant role in its performance. A server with high traffic and too many users may experience slower speeds and instability. When testing proxies, try to find out how many users are sharing the server’s resources, as this can directly affect the quality of the service.

Conclusion

In conclusion, testing the speed and stability of a proxy server is essential to determine whether it meets your needs for online activities. By using speed test websites, running continuous ping tests, and monitoring connection stability over time, you can accurately assess the performance of a proxy. Additionally, considering factors like the type of proxy, its location, and the server load will give you a better understanding of its overall reliability. By following these methods, you can make a well-informed decision when selecting a proxy server that provides fast and stable service for your internet activities.